Transaction 50f73be88c802875a1496eb7fbceec2f80cd9060bf66ea7c1a5f6d4ab9dc8ac3

1 Input
1 Outputs
  • 50f73be88c802875a1496eb7fbceec2f80cd9060bf66ea7c1a5f6d4ab9dc8ac3:0
  • value  3091027263
    address  3HT1MVQzBbphZzESS5e36E68XqycDu8xEr